The Belgium women's national under-21 field hockey team represents Belgium in women's international under-21 field hockey competitions and is controlled by the Royal Belgian Hockey Association, the governing body for field hockey in Belgium.[1] The team plays in the EuroHockey Junior Championships and has qualified three times for the Junior World Cup.
